    Abstract: A sealing structure for a gas turbine engine includes a rotor that has a rim with slots and a cooling passage. The rotor is rotatable about an axis. First and second blades are arranged in the slots and respectively including first and second shelves facing one another within a pocket that is in fluid communication with the cooling passage. The first and second shelves form an opening. A reversible seal is arranged within the pocket and has a body that is configured for operative association with the first and second blades in any of four orientations to seal the opening in a first condition. The seal includes first and second protrusions respectively extending from first and second faces opposing one another. The first protrusions supported on the rim in a first condition.

    Abstract: Additional document information may be stored through change tracking. In some examples, an application, such as a document processing application, may allow collaborative creation and/or editing of a document. As individual collaborators enter new content or make changes to existing content, the new content and/or changes go through two phases. As an individual collaborator is editing, the change is temporary. The collaborator may decide not to integrate it to the document. The temporary content may become permanent or integrated through a save action (manual or automatic). In some examples, the temporary content may be shared with other collaborators through a scheme to indicate its status as temporary giving the collaborators a true collaboration experience.

    Abstract: An adjustable belt for wearing around a user's waist is disclosed. The belt comprises a strap for placement around the user's waist. A buckle is coupled to a first end of the strap and is configured for accepting a second end of the strap and adjusting a length of the strap. The buckle further comprises a plurality of gears that mate with gear teeth located on an outward facing surface of the strap, such that movement of the second end of the strap within the buckle moves the plurality of gears; a spring loaded ratchet that contacts the gear teeth of the plurality of gears, such that the ratchet only allows movement of the plurality of gears in one direction; and a lever coupled to the spring loaded ratchet, such that activating the lever allows for movement of the plurality of gears in both directions.

    Abstract: An airfoil stage of a turbine engine includes an upstream airfoil assembly, a downstream airfoil assembly in rotational relationship to the upstream airfoil assembly and a rim seal assembly integrated therebetween. The rim seal assembly may include a sloped downstream portion of a platform of the upstream airfoil assembly, an upstream segment of a platform of the downstream airfoil assembly and a nub that projects radially outward from the upstream segment. The downstream portion and the upstream segment are spaced from one-another defining a cooling cavity therebetween for the flow of cooling air. The portion and segment overlap axially such that the nub is axially aligned to the downstream portion for improved cooling effectiveness and a reduction of core airflow into the cooling cavity.
